The cheapest way to get from Lake Lucerne to Avignon is to bus which costs €60 - €110 and takes 12h 54m.
The fastest way to get from Lake Lucerne to Avignon is to train and fly which takes 5h 33m and costs €90 - €260.
No, there is no direct bus from Lake Lucerne to Avignon. However, there are services departing from Luzern, Werkhofstrasse and arriving at Avignon via Lucerne Landenbergstrasse, Zurich Bus Station and Lyon.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 12h 54m.
No, there is no direct train from Lake Lucerne to Avignon. However, there are services departing from Luzern and arriving at Avignon Tgv via Genève, Bellegarde and Lyon Part Dieu.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 8h 44m.
The distance between Lake Lucerne and Avignon is 655 km. The road distance is 577.6 km.
The best way to get from Lake Lucerne to Avignon without a car is to train which takes 8h 44m and costs €160 - €450.
It takes approximately 8h 44m to get from Lake Lucerne to Avignon, including transfers.
